To help launch Healthy UC Davis' "Healthy Outside" initiative, the UC Davis community of students, faculty, academics and staff is encouraged to share how nature improves their mental health and well-being during the Healthy Outside Campaign Challenge.
The Health TEAM Lab provides UC Davis students, staff, and faculty a place to: learn about health literacy, receive standardized health metric testing/reporting, and communicate with a support group to help facilitate healthy behavior changes.
Since 2016, Davis Period and #FreethePeriod, along with the Menstrual Equity Task Force, have been working to combat Period Poverty. We believe menstrual hygiene products are a basic necessity just like soap or toilet paper, and that no student should have to sacrifice education due to lack of access.
Helmet Hair Don't Care is a campus-wide bike safety initiative that will provide bike safety training and free bike helmets to students, staff, and faculty.
A pilot program to bring Walker Tracker, a physical activity platform, to the UC Davis community. The program encourages friendly competition to increase physical activity through virtual challenge maps and device synchronization.
A collaborative effort between Healthy UC Davis and dining services at Davis and Sacramento campuses with a goal to develop healthy catering menus are affordable rates for departments and programs to access.
An educational campaign focused on increasing the campus community's awareness of the potential harms of vaping and use of other electronic cigarette devices.
A partnership between UC Davis and the Truth Initiative utilizing the Truth Initiative's evidence-informed EX Program, an app and web-based service that helps folks quit using tobacco.
